Take It BackReiko

REIKO ‘Take It Back (Prod. Sam is Ohm)’ Music Video
Take It BackReiko

This R&B number is an homage to the late-’80s to early-’90s music style reminiscent of New Jack Swing, seamlessly fused with contemporary arrangements.

Over a powerful beat and sophisticated production, REIKO’s soulful vocals cut straight to the heart.

Centered on the theme of “liberating your true self,” the lyrics give voice to the feelings of young people who often find themselves bound by social constraints and others’ expectations, resonating with many listeners.

Released in April 2025, the song is positioned as the first installment of REIKO’s R&B trilogy.

Produced by Sam is Ohm, it blends a ’90s nostalgic aura with fresh sound design to deliver a distinctly modern appeal.

Perfect for a drive or a mood reset, it’s an ideal track for anyone looking to make a fresh start in life.

ROSEHANA

HANA / ROSE -Music Video-
ROSEHANA

In 2025, HANA—a seven-member female group that could well be called one of the year’s most talked-about acts—burst onto the scene.

Produced by CHANMINA, their fluid movement between hip-hop and R&B, paired with world-class sound quality, made a powerful impact both in Japan and abroad.

Their debut track “ROSE,” released in April 2025, was an undeniable hit, racking up 15 million views on YouTube within three weeks and showcasing the immense potential of all seven members.

With a firm “no lip-syncing” policy, their talent is obvious from the official live performances available—though of course, attempting their songs at karaoke will demand a comparable level of vocal skill.

From robust, R&B-inflected vocals that soar across high and low registers to razor-sharp rap, if you and your confident singer friends can pull off a faithful recreation, you’ll undoubtedly be the stars of the night at karaoke!

ReawakeR (feat. Felix of Stray Kids)LiSA

LiSA『ReawakeR (feat. Felix of Stray Kids)』MUSiC CLiP
ReawakeR (feat. Felix of Stray Kids)LiSA

An unconventional collaboration that fuses a powerful rock sound with electronic elements.

LiSA’s soaring vocals and Stray Kids’ Felix’s weighty rap blend in exquisite balance, weaving an epic story themed around rebirth and defying fate.

The dynamic sound crafted by Hiroyuki Sawano makes this a track that gives listeners a strong push forward.

The song has been selected as the opening theme for the TV anime “Solo Leveling Season 2 -Arise from the Shadow-,” airing from January 2025.

Its energetic development and positive message are sure to resonate with those embarking on new challenges or wishing to change themselves.

LOVE IS THE STRONGESTNEW!May’n

Since her major debut in 2005, singer May’n has continued to captivate fans around the world with her genre-defying expressiveness.

Released for streaming in February 2026, the year marking the 20th anniversary of her debut, this track was selected as the opening theme for the tokusatsu drama “Super Space Sheriff Gavan Infinity.” It also drew attention as her first involvement in a tokusatsu production.

Its fiery lyrics, which question the meaning of “love,” resonate beyond the boundaries of a hero-themed work.

A sense of grandeur emerges from the fusion of a high-velocity, brass-forward ensemble and her piercing high-tone vocals.

vivariumNEW!Ado

[Ado] Vivarium (Official Audio)
vivariumNEW!Ado

With her overwhelming vocal prowess taking the music scene by storm, singer Ado is now attracting global attention.

“Vivarium” is a digital single released in February 2026, created in tandem with her autobiographical novel, “Vivarium: Ado and Me,” which traces her life story.

It also drew buzz for being written and composed by Ado herself.

Arrangement was handled by Takayoshi “CO-K” Kokei, who also serves as her live bandmaster.

The lyrics, which lay bare her inner conflicts and pain, pierce deeply alongside a driving rock sound.

An emotional rock tune that’s a must-listen—even for those who aren’t already fans.

SPECIALZKing Gnu

TV anime Jujutsu Kaisen Season 2 “Shibuya Incident” non-credit opening movie / Opening theme: King Gnu “SPECIALZ” | Airing every Thursday at 11:56 PM on 28 MBS/TBS network stations nationwide!!
SPECIALZKing Gnu

King Gnu is a four-piece rock band that’s taking the J-pop scene by storm with each member’s exceptional musicianship and diverse musical backgrounds.

Their 7th single “SPECIALZ,” chosen as the opening theme for the second season of the TV anime Jujutsu Kaisen (the Shibuya Incident arc), features a loose, laid-back sound and a floating ensemble that evokes the anime’s worldview.

Its dramatic song structure lets you fully experience King Gnu’s appeal.

Though it’s a challenging track, it’s a cool rock tune that you can still have fun singing at karaoke.
